Main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Plan and provide specialist support to pupils with identified disabilities, SEN, sensory impairments, and complex needs to access a broad and balanced curriculum by modifying and adapting learning activities as appropriate.
  • Support the special education and personal social wellbeing of pupils by adapting and differentiating activities to enable them to access the curriculum under the direction and guidance of teachers or advisory staff.
  • Assess, record, and report on development, progress, and attainment using detailed specialist knowledge.
  • Support parents to understand their children’s complex needs and provide sound advice regarding their child’s education.
  • Provide appropriate supervision to individuals or groups in various settings, including school, pupils' home environments, or units, monitoring their conduct and behaviour.

We Are Looking For Someone Who Has:

  • NVQ level 2 or equivalent qualification (e.g., Teaching Assistant awards, English/Maths GCSE (A*-C or 9-4), Level 2 Basic Skills Literacy, CACHE Level 2 Certificate in Child Care and Education).
  • Experience working with children of the relevant age group.
  • Knowledge and understanding of at least one area of learning (e.g., English, Maths, Science, SEN, Early Years, and KS 3 Strategy for literacy or numeracy).
  • Ability to plan work and exercise initiative and independent action.
  • Ability to relate well to adults and children, understanding their learning difficulties and needs.

Commitment to safeguarding

Our organisation is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people and vulnerable adults. We expect all staff, volunteers and trustees to share this commitment.

Our recruitment process follows the keeping children safe in education guidance.

Offers of employment may be subject to the following checks (where relevant):
childcare disqualification
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S)
medical
online and social media
prohibition from teaching
right to work
satisfactory references
suitability to work with children

You must tell us about any unspent conviction, cautions, reprimands or warnings under the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975.
